Generation: 1

  1. 1.  Agnes Culpepper was born on 3 May 1803 in Chatham Co, Georgia (daughter of Christopher Culpepper and Ceclia Moreland); died on 10 Jun 1880 in Lee Co, Alabama.

    Agnes married Thomas B. Martin, (immigrant)Statesville, Iredell Co, North Carolina. Thomas was born about 1785 in Dublin, Co Dublin, Ireland; died on 3 Jul 1870 in Lee Co, Alabama. [Group Sheet] [Family Chart]

    Children:
    1. John H. Martin was born on 17 Apr 1833 in Georgia; died on 23 Feb 1880 in Lee Co, Alabama.

Generation: 2

  1. 2.  Christopher Culpepper was born about 1761 in North Carolina (son of James Culpepper); died in 1831 in Muscogee Co, Georgia.

    Christopher married Ceclia Moreland about 1796 in Nash, North Carolina. Ceclia was born about 1770 in South Carolina; died about 1832 in Muscogee Co, Georgia. [Group Sheet] [Family Chart]


  2. 3.  Ceclia Moreland was born about 1770 in South Carolina; died about 1832 in Muscogee Co, Georgia.
    Children:
    1. 1. Agnes Culpepper was born on 3 May 1803 in Chatham Co, Georgia; died on 10 Jun 1880 in Lee Co, Alabama.


Generation: 3

  1. 4.  James Culpepper was born about 1729 in Norfolk Co, Virginia (son of Robert Culpepper); died about Nov 1799 in Nash, North Carolina.
    Children:
    1. 2. Christopher Culpepper was born about 1761 in North Carolina; died in 1831 in Muscogee Co, Georgia.


Generation: 4

  1. 8.  Robert Culpepper was born about 1700 in Norfolk Co, Virginia (son of Robert Culpepper, (DNA-LL)); died in Oct 1774 in Norfolk Co, Virginia.
    Children:
    1. 4. James Culpepper was born about 1729 in Norfolk Co, Virginia; died about Nov 1799 in Nash, North Carolina.
